ALEXANDRIA, Va., March 26 -- United States Patent no. 12,257,145, issued on March 25, was assigned to Hoya Medical Singapore Pte. Ltd. (Singapore).

"Intraocular lens injector with container" was invented by Kazunori Kudo (Saku, Japan).
